Question 1164750: A Manufacturer of microcomputers produces three different models as shown in Table 2. The following summarizes wholesale prices, material cost per unit, and labor cost per unit.Annual fixed cost are $25 million.
Model 1 Model 2 Model 3
Wholesale price/unit 500 1000 1500
Material Cost / unit 175 400 750
Labor cost / unit 100 150 225
i. Determine a joint revenue function for sales of the three different microcomputer models
ii. Determine the annual costs function for the manufacturing the three models.
iii. Determine the profit function for sales of the three models?

You can put this solution on YOUR website! x = number of model 1 microcomputers
y = number of model 2 microcomputers
z = number of model 3 microcomputers
wholesale price per unit = 500x + 1000y + 1500z
material cost per unit = 175x + 400y + 750z
labor cost per unit = 100x + 150y + 225z
annual fixed costs are 25,000,000
total revenue = 500x + 1000y + 1500z
annual costs for the manufacture of the 3 models is 25,000,000 + (175x + 400y + 750z) + (100x + 150y + 225z)
combine like terms to get:
annual costs for the manufacture of the 3 models is 25,000,000 + 275x + 550y + 975z
the profit function is the revenue minus the cost.
that would be 500x + 1000y + 1500z - 25,000,000 - 275x - 550y - 975z
the per unit costs are for the whole year, as is the fixed cost.
